If Social Security decides to waive the overpayment, this means that you do not have to repay the money to Social Security. Social Security should also refund any part of the overpayment that they already collected from you.

If you do not agree that you have been overpaid, or if you believe the amount is incorrect, you can appeal by filing Form SSA-561, Request for Reconsideration. You should explain why you think you have not been overpaid or why you think the amount is not correct.

If you don't agree that you've been overpaid, or you believe the overpayment amount is incorrect, you can request a reconsideration. We call this an appeal.

Benefits are overpaid when we can't accurately calculate your benefit amount because our information is wrong or incomplete. It can happen if you don't share updates with us about what's changed in your life, like your ability to work, living situation, marital status, or income.

A. Description of the SSA-3105 We enclose form SSA-3105, ?Important Information about Your Appeal, Waiver Rights, and Repayment Options,? with all Title II initial overpayment notices. This form gives overpaid individuals additional information regarding their reconsideration and waiver rights.
